Description

n-(5-Hydroxy-1-Naphthyl)Acetamide is a specialized organic intermediate featuring a naphthalene core substituted with both acetamide and hydroxyl functional groups. This molecular structure makes it a valuable building block for synthesizing more complex chemical entities, particularly in the pharmaceutical and advanced materials sectors. It is primarily sought after by research and development chemists and process engineers in fine chemical manufacturing.

Application

  • Pharmaceutical Intermediate: Key precursor in the synthesis of active pharmaceutical ingredients (APIs), particularly those with naphthalene-based structures for therapeutic applications.
  • Dye and Pigment Synthesis: Serves as a starting material for manufacturing certain azo dyes and high-performance organic pigments due to its aromatic system and functional groups.
  • Agrochemical Research: Used in the development of novel agrochemicals, where its structure can contribute to the biological activity of herbicides or fungicides.
  • Liquid Crystal and OLED Materials: Potential building block for organic electronic materials, where its planar, conjugated structure is beneficial for charge transport.
  • Chemical Research & Development: Employed in academic and industrial R&D labs for exploring new organic reactions and creating novel compound libraries.

Basic Information

Product Name n-(5-Hydroxy-1-Naphthyl)Acetamide
CAS No. 22302-65-4
Molecular Formula C₁₂H₁₁NO₂
Molecular Weight 201.22 g/mol
Synonyms 5-Acetamido-1-naphthol; 1-Naphthol, 5-acetamido-; N-Acetyl-5-amino-1-naphthol; 5-Hydroxy-1-naphthylacetamide; 1-Naphthylamine-5-ol, N-acetyl-; 5-(Acetylamino)-1-naphthalenol; Acetamide, N-(5-hydroxy-1-naphthyl)-

Storage

Preserve in a tightly closed container, protected from light. Store in a cool, dry, and well-ventilated area at room temperature (15-25°C). Keep away from incompatible materials such as strong oxidizing agents.
